A power bank is a portable device that stores energy from an external source, such as a wall outlet or USB port, and delivers it as needed to charge other electronic devices, such as smartphones, tablets, and laptops. Here’s how they work:
Energy storage: Power banks have a battery inside that stores energy when it’s charged. The battery can be made of various materials, such as lithium-ion or nickel-metal hydride, and its capacity is measured in milliampere-hours (mAh). The higher the capacity, the more energy the power bank can store and deliver.
Charging process: To charge the power bank, you need to connect it to an external source of power, such as a wall outlet or USB port, using a charging cable. The battery inside the power bank then absorbs the energy and stores it for later use. The charging process takes some time, but it varies depending on the capacity of the battery and the charging speed.
Power delivery: To deliver the stored energy to another device, you need to connect the power bank to the device using a USB cable. The power bank then delivers the energy from its battery to the device, which starts charging. The charging speed depends on the capacity of the power bank, the type of device being charged, and the charging speed of the device.
Safety features: Power banks have several safety features built-in to prevent overcharging, overheating, and short-circuits. For example, most power banks have built-in voltage and current regulators, as well as temperature sensors, that monitor the charging process and cut off the power delivery if anything goes wrong.
LED indicators: Power banks often have LED indicators that show the remaining battery capacity and the charging status. Some power banks also have an LED flashlight, which can come in handy in low-light situations.
